    Quite a few reasons


    A. They are bright, not helpful unless you want to be seen

    B. Either you get tunneled or camped because bright colors obviously = Cocky Survivor gotta show them legacy players or the killer avoids chasing you all game because you might be to good

    C. Being accused of being a cheater, sure nothing happens, but it doesn't make a person feel good, especially when they rightfully earned it

    D. There are cooler outfits than a glowing stock outfit, people have different tastes


    Personally I like all the other choices. It was cool at the time when it was a choice between some stock clothes, Prestige clothes, or DLC bundled clothes. But more and more stuff come out. Most of which looks fantastic.

    A big reason is also that the majority of players who played in 2016 and got Legacy have long stopped playing this game and many have lost their Legacies during the Progress Loss epidemic that happened in 2017. The devs never reinstated those even though they had promised multiple times.

    I have two pieces of Legacy: Dwight's Shirt and Wraith's Weapon. I rarely wear Dwight's Legacy shirt, and even though I use the Legacy weapon on Wraith, few people still recognise it for that (many assume it's the Hallowed Blight skin) and I don't play him that often.
